Sea to Sky Regional Heritage Fair (Grades 4-12)

Offered by North Vancouver Museum Archives and last updated on March 01, 2011.

Description

Participate in a national program and highlight your students' history projects! Using your current classroom curricula, encourage your students to explore local and Canadian history. The subjects are endless - native studies, historic events, sports heroes and local industry are just some that come to mind! Feature their projects on a parent-teacher night or hold a classroom open house for other classes to attend. Then, select a few project for the 10th Annual Sea to Sky Regional Heritage Fair to be held on May 7th, 2011. The Heritage Fair program is a wonderful way to encourage all students to explore Canadian heritage in a dynamic and hands-on learning environment.
